function formValidatorContact() { // check to see if the field is blank if (document.form.name_from.value == "") { alert("Please enter your name."); document.form.name_from.focus(); return (false); } // test if valid email address, must have @ and . var checkEmail = "@."; var checkStr = document.form.email_from.value; var EmailValid = false; var EmailAt = false; var EmailPeriod = false; for (i = 0; i < checkStr.length; i++) { ch = checkStr.charAt(i); for (j = 0; j < checkEmail.length; j++) { if (ch == checkEmail.charAt(j) && ch == "@") EmailAt = true; if (ch == checkEmail.charAt(j) && ch == ".") EmailPeriod = true; if (EmailAt && EmailPeriod) break; if (j == checkEmail.length) break; } // if both the @ and . were in the string if (EmailAt && EmailPeriod) { EmailValid = true break; } } if (!EmailValid) { alert("Please enter a valid email address."); document.form.email_from.focus(); return (false); } // check to see if the field is blank if (document.form.Country.value == "") { alert("Please select a country."); document.form.Country.focus(); return (false); } // check to see if the field is blank if (document.form.Message.value == "") { alert("Please enter a message."); document.form.Message.focus(); return (false); } } function formValidatorInquire() { // test if valid email address, must have @ and . var checkEmail = "@."; var checkStr = document.form.email_from.value; var EmailValid = false; var EmailAt = false; var EmailPeriod = false; for (i = 0; i < checkStr.length; i++) { ch = checkStr.charAt(i); for (j = 0; j < checkEmail.length; j++) { if (ch == checkEmail.charAt(j) && ch == "@") EmailAt = true; if (ch == checkEmail.charAt(j) && ch == ".") EmailPeriod = true; if (EmailAt && EmailPeriod) break; if (j == checkEmail.length) break; } // if both the @ and . were in the string if (EmailAt && EmailPeriod) { EmailValid = true break; } } if (!EmailValid) { alert("Please enter a valid email address."); document.form.email_from.focus(); return (false); } }